Claire Brind was a character in The Bill from 1988 until 1989.

WPC Claire Brind was a Londoner, from south of the river. She was bright and forthright but slightly accident-prone. The daughter of a former DI (who retired on medical grounds following injuries sustained in an off-duty road accident) and still a serving District Nurse, Claire joined the station as a probationer. The butt of jokes both in the station and on the streets, she struggled to assert her authority and disliked certain aspects of the job.

Although she occasionally showed commendable initiative, her moaning and poor timekeeping did not exactly endear her to her sergeants - but Claire was one of Burnside's favourite WPCs to use for plain clothes operations - she was on hand in the hospital when Burnside's goddaughter died and he appreciated her tactful handling of the situation. She left Sun Hill 1989.
